Are there any batch jobs to switch the costing method from weighted average to standard costing?
Instead of using P4105 and change item by item. Add unit cost for '07' and switch the item from '02' to '07'.

Then use P41021 to review the journal entries.
We have dozens of branchplants and more than 30k active items.
There is too much manual tasks to be performed.
Are there other processes which I must look out for before and after the change in cost method?

If you are a manufacturing environment you can use the normal JDE cost roll process to roll your 02 cost into your 07 cost. P30820 and P30835. Otherwise you might look at the P41052.

I would also strongly urge you to try this in a test environment first so your finance group can review any ramifications.

Sorry - Almost forgot, you would also need to change the inventory costing selection in your branch plant constants.

I am not sure, but this may not update the hidden flag in the P4105 file COCSIN. This would also need to be tested. If it does not automatically update this for all items, an SQL would need to be run or program written to change the flag to blank for your 02 records and to an I for your 07 records.

Again, the entire process will need to be thoroughly tested.
